About this artwork
Venus rode a wave shaped like a fancy French curve. The machinations of time and space moved forward and back like mighty gears that made sense to no one. Beings and non-beings bumped, collided, sputtered, and flowed. Creatures strange and ancient looked on in judgment. The camel looked on impassively while others hissed with envy. Simple forms of life wriggled with the need to self-sustain.
Space could not be defined and therefore could not be… claimed – although many would try.
Alan MacIntyre, a painter, printmaker, and sculptor with a BFA from the University of Guelph, crafts captivating mixed-media reliefs rooted in sculpture, painting, and printmaking. His improvisational process layers free-flowing acrylics, cut hardboard, and collage into dimensional works alive with energy and mythic narrative. By assembling recurring figures—dogs, camels, goddesses—he evokes tension, conflict, and eventual harmony. Each piece vibrates with playful strangeness and vital, raw emotion, drawing viewers into a world where chaos and resolution beautifully collide.

How artists price their creations?
The level of exposure
(local, national, or international)
The price range on the market trends and similar background
The recent major accomplishments
(a prize, a residency, a publication, a solo exhibition in a renowned gallery or art fair, a collaboration with a famous brand, etc...)
The year of realisation
(young or mature realisation)
The certification(s)
such as I-CAC for France or AKOUN for international
The master style, the “quote”
(if they are well know for a specific style or if they are trying a new period)
The materials, edition or time of production
The techniques, support and dimension of the piece
